1. Understanding the Ram 1500 Engine Lineup
Before purchasing any spare parts, it is crucial to determine the specific engine set up in the lorry. [Buy Dodge Ram 1500 USA](https://blogfreely.net/brokerkitten9/think-youre-the-perfect-candidate-for-doing-dodge-ram-engine-spare-part) (and later, RAM) has actually used a number of engines over the last 20 years, each requiring specific elements.
5.7 L HEMI ® V8: The most popular engine option, popular for its "HEMI" hemispherical combustion chambers. It typically features the Multi-Displacement System (MDS) for fuel efficiency.3.6 L Pentastar ™ V6: Known for its dependability and balance, frequently paired with the eTorque mild-hybrid system in newer models.3.0 L EcoDiesel V6: Popular amongst those looking for high torque and much better fuel economy for long-distance towing.4.7 L Magnum V8: Found in older generations (pre-2013), this engine was a workhorse of the mid-2000s designs.Table 1: Common Ram 1500 Engine SpecificationsEngine TypeDisplacementCommon Use YearsSecret FeatureHEMI V85.7 Liter2003-- PresentHigh horsepower & & MDS technologyPentastar V63.6 Liter2013-- PresentFuel effectiveness & & eTorque availabilityEcoDiesel V63.0 Liter2014-- 2023Superior torque & & diesel economyMagnum V84.7 Liter2002-- 2013Resilient, traditional V8 design2. Essential Engine Spare Parts Categories
When a [Buy Dodge Ram 1500 Truck Engine Spare Part USA](https://hedgedoc.eclair.ec-lyon.fr/s/JKHwsdTNR) Ram 1500 requires repair, the parts normally fall under three categories: Routine Maintenance, Critical Mechanical, and Sensors/Electronics.
Regular Maintenance Parts
These are the products changed most often to prevent significant engine failure. They include:
Oil Filters: Essential for keeping the engine oil free of contaminants.Air Filters: Crucial for preserving the correct air-fuel ratio and protecting the cylinders from dust.Stimulate Plugs: Particularly important for the 5.7 L HEMI, which utilizes 16 trigger plugs (2 per cylinder) to ensure total combustion.Important Mechanical Components
If the truck experiences performance issues or weird sounds (like the notorious "HEMI tick"), these parts may be required:
Water Pumps: Responsible for flowing coolant to prevent overheating.Timing Chain Kits: Essential for synchronizing the rotation of the crankshaft and the camshaft.Fuel Injectors: Responsible for delivering an accurate mist of fuel into the combustion chamber.Sensing units and Electronics
Modern Ram 1500s count on a network of sensors to optimize efficiency:
Oxygen (O2) Sensors: Monitor exhaust gases to change fuel delivery.Camshaft/Crankshaft Position Sensors: These tell the engine computer system precisely when to fire the trigger plugs.3. Where to Buy Ram 1500 Engine Parts in the USA
The American market uses a number of opportunities for buying engine parts. The choice typically depends on the budget, the age of the truck, and how quickly the part is needed.
Official Mopar Dealerships
Mopar is the initial devices producer (OEM) for RAM. Buying from a dealership ensures that the part is developed particularly for that VIN. While usually the most pricey alternative, it uses the very best fitment and warranty protection.
Online Specialized Retailers
Sites like RockAuto, Summit Racing, and JEGS are popular for United States truck owners. They provide a wide variety of brand names, from economy options to high-performance upgrades. These websites permit users to compare costs instantly throughout different manufacturers.
Local Auto Parts Stores
Nationwide chains like AutoZone, O'Reilly Auto Parts, and Advance Auto Parts are exceptional for typical products like belts, hose pipes, and filters. They typically offer "loaner tools" for DIY repairs and have a robust return policy for regional clients.
Aftermarket vs. OEM: Making the ChoiceOEM (Mopar): Best for critical internal engine components (gaskets, timing sets) and electronics where accuracy is absolute.Aftermarket (High-Quality): Brands like Mahle, Gates, Bosch, and Fel-Pro often produce parts that meet or surpass OEM requirements at a lower rate point.Aftermarket (Performance): For owners seeking to increase horse power, brands like K&N (filters) or Holley (fuel systems) are preferred.4.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: What is the "HEMI Tick," and what parts do I require to fix it?
A: The "HEMI tick" is frequently triggered by damaged manifold bolts or failing lifters/camshafts. Depending upon the medical diagnosis, you may require a manifold bolt set, brand-new exhaust gaskets, or a full lifter and camshaft replacement kit.
Q2: Can I use 87 octane gas in my 5.7 L HEMI?
A: While 87 octane is appropriate, RAM formally recommends 89 octane for optimal efficiency and to avoid "engine ping," which can lead to long-lasting wear on internal engine parts.
Q3: Are diesel engine parts more expensive than gas parts?
A: Generally, yes. Spare parts for the 3.0 L EcoDiesel (such as fuel injectors, high-pressure fuel pumps, and turbochargers) tend to bring a greater cost tag due to the complexity and precision required in diesel injection systems.
Q4: How do I understand if I have the eTorque system?
A: You can examine the engine bay; the eTorque-equipped V6 or V8 will have a large belt-driven motor-generator unit where a conventional generator would normally sit. This needs a specific durable serpentine belt.
Q5: Is it safe to purchase "utilized" engine parts from a salvage yard?
A: For non-wear items like intake manifolds, oil pans, or engine covers, utilized parts are fine. However, internal components like bearings, rings, or timing chains must constantly be purchased new.
